High-Protein Korean Beef Bowls

This High-Protein Korean Beef Bowl is everything I want after a long day. It’s fast, it’s flavorful, and it gives takeout energy without the mystery macros. The ground beef gets simmered in a garlicky, ginger-spiked soy glaze and layered over warm rice with a jammy egg and fresh toppings. Clean, simple, delicious. great for recovery, and energy, and helps you stay full without needing a snack an hour later.

I started making this to break out of the plain chicken rut, and it’s been in my weekly meal prep rotation ever since. The flavor hits hard, and it’s endlessly customizable—go spicy, low-carb, or double protein.

This is a photo of high-protein Korean beef bowl.

Why This Recipe Rocks

Protein-packed: The combination of lean ground beef, eggs, and rice gives you over 40g of protein per serving.

No fuss: Simple ingredients, one pan, and no complicated steps. It’s a reliable, weeknight-friendly recipe you can make on autopilot.

Customizable: Serve it over white rice, brown rice, or cauliflower rice. Add veggies, double the beef—whatever fits your goals.

What you’ll need for this Recipe

Ground beef – Lean ground beef keeps the fat lower and protein higher, but you can use regular or even ground turkey if you prefer.

Eggs – A soft, runny yolk makes this dish even more indulgent and adds extra protein.

Soy sauce – The key to deep umami richness.

Honey – Adds natural sweetness and balances the saltiness.

Rice vinegar – A touch of tang to cut through the richness.

Garlic, minced – A must-have for that classic Korean flavor.

Ginger – Fresh ginger gives the dish that signature Korean-style depth—don’t skip it if you want the flavor to really pop.

Onion, finely diced – This adds a bit of sweetness and texture.

Scallions, sliced – Scallions bring freshness and a mild onion kick.

Fresh chilies, sliced – Optional but highly recommended for heat!

How to Make It

Cook your rice first so it’s ready to go when the beef is done.

In a skillet, brown the ground beef over medium heat. Drain excess fat if needed.

Add the onion, garlic, and ginger, and sauté for 2-3 minutes until soft and fragrant.

Stir in soy sauce, honey, and rice vinegar. Simmer for 2-3 minutes until the sauce thickens slightly.

Assemble the bowls: scoop rice into your bowl, top with beef, then pile on scallions, fresh chilies, and a soft-boiled or fried egg.

Macros & Nutrition Breakdown Per Serving

Note: These macros are based on the exact ingredient amounts listed above and a serving size of about 1/4th of the recipe, with ½ cup cooked white rice each. (These values are estimates and can vary depending on the exact ingredients used and portion sizes.)

  • Servings: 4
  • Calories: 536
  • Protein: 41g
  • Carbs: 35g
  • Fat: 25g
  • Fiber: 1g

Meal Prep & Storage Tips

Make it ahead – The beef actually tastes better the next day as the flavors soak in. Cook a double batch and portion it out over rice or cauliflower rice for easy grab-and-go meals.

Keep toppings separate – Store scallions, chilies, and eggs separately and add them fresh when serving. This keeps everything tasting vibrant instead of soggy.

Reheat like a pro – Warm the beef gently in a skillet or microwave with a splash of water to keep the sauce glossy and the texture just right.

Fridge life – The cooked beef will last up to 4 days in the fridge. Eggs can be soft-boiled in advance and peeled day-of for the perfect jammy yolk.

Freezer-friendly? – Yep. The beef freezes well—just leave off the toppings. Let it cool completely, then freeze in airtight containers for up to 2 months.

More Recipes You’ll Love

Protein Pasta Salad

Oats and Yogurt

High-Protein Korean Beef Bowl

High-Protein Korean Beef Bowl

Yield: 4
Prep Time: 10 minutes
Cook Time: 15 minutes
Total Time: 25 minutes

A quick, high-protein Korean beef bowl made with a sweet and savory soy-ginger glaze, served over rice and topped with scallions, chilies, and a jammy egg.

Ingredients

  • 1 pound ground beef
  • 3 tbsp soy sauce
  • 2 tbsp honey
  • 2 tbsp rice vinegar
  • ½ small onion, finely diced
  • 1 tsp garlic, minced
  • 1 tsp ginger, minced
  • ½ cup scallions, sliced
  • 4 eggs
  • Fresh chilies, sliced
  • 2 cups cooked rice to serve

Instructions

  1. Brown the Beef: In a skillet over medium heat, cook the ground beef until it's nicely browned. Drain excess fat if needed.
  2. Build the Flavor Stir in the onion and garlic, cooking for about 2 minutes until fragrant.
  3. Sauce it Up: Add soy sauce, honey, and rice vinegar. Stir well and let simmer for 2-3 minutes until slightly thickened.
  4. Assemble the Bowl: Serve the beef over steamed rice, then top with scallions, fresh chilies, and a fried egg.

Notes

Meal prep tip – Let the beef cool before sealing it in containers to avoid condensation and sogginess.

Nutrition Information:
Yield: 4 Serving Size: 1
Amount Per Serving: Calories: 536Total Fat: 25gSaturated Fat: 9gTrans Fat: 1gUnsaturated Fat: 12gCholesterol: 287mgSodium: 838mgCarbohydrates: 35gFiber: 1gSugar: 10gProtein: 41g

Nutrition information on That Protein Life is estimated using online calculators and may vary based on ingredients, brands, and preparation methods. For the most accurate results, use a food scale and trusted calculator. This information is for general guidance only—please consult a professional for specific dietary needs. That Protein Life is not responsible for any discrepancies or outcomes.

Did you make this recipe?

Please leave a comment on the blog or share a photo on Instagram

Similar Posts

2 Comments

Leave a Reply

Your email address will not be published. Required fields are marked *